Система Домов
#1

Пмогите мне написал систему домов на MXINI а эта ересь работать не хочет
http://pastebin.com/3imvcy7S -- ссылко
Reply
#2

извлекай строку и дели её sparam'om и всё
Reply
#3

pawn Code:
for(new i = 0; i < MAX_HOUSES; i++)
    {
        if(HouseInfo[i][hOwned] == 0)
        {
            SetPlayerMapIcon(31, 0, HouseInfo[i][hEntrancePosX], HouseInfo[i][hEntrancePosY], HouseInfo[i][hEntrancePosZ],52,0);
            CreatePickup(1273, 1, HouseInfo[i][hEntrancePosX], HouseInfo[i][hEntrancePosY], HouseInfo[i][hEntrancePosZ]);
        }
        else
        {
            SetPlayerMapIcon(32, 0, HouseInfo[i][hEntrancePosX], HouseInfo[i][hEntrancePosY], HouseInfo[i][hEntrancePosZ],52,0);
            CreatePickup(1272, 1, HouseInfo[i][hEntrancePosX], HouseInfo[i][hEntrancePosY], HouseInfo[i][hEntrancePosZ]);
        }
    }
Почему то создается на нолевых координатах на ферме=)
Reply
#4

не правильно извлекаешь из файла данные
Reply
#5

можно подробней в каких строках ошибки?
Reply
#6

Quote:
Originally Posted by sk47
View Post
можно подробней в каких строках ошибки?
Где то там где у тебя LoadHouse или чё там у тебя..
Reply
#7

DapkMapk я знаю что там я просто c MXINI до этого не работал
мне бы точные строчки где неправильно
Reply
#8

все уже не нужно сделал на file.inc
так как зиги сказал что муторно на MXINI
Reply
#9

на mxINI ещё легче мне кажется=)
Reply
#10

Quote:
Originally Posted by sk47
View Post
все уже не нужно сделал на file.inc
так как зиги сказал что муторно на MXINI
Quote:
Originally Posted by Johnny_Xayc
View Post
на mxINI ещё легче мне кажется=)
не муторно и ни чуть не легче... Это просто без смысленно, т.к. в случае у sk47, ключ не нужен, а mxini работает с ключём..
Reply
#11

что мешает добавить в файл ключ для каждой строки?(не в ручную а скриптом(быстрее будет)) и потом юзать спокойно...извлекаешь строку,а дальше либо split либо sparam на усмотрение...
Reply
#12

Quote:
Originally Posted by Johnny_Xayc
View Post
что мешает добавить в файл ключ для каждой строки?(не в ручную а скриптом(быстрее будет)) и потом юзать спокойно...извлекаешь строку,а дальше либо split либо sparam на усмотрение...
спрашивается: нахрена?
fwrite, я уже извлекаю нужную мне строку и "дальше либо split либо sparam на усмотрение...", в его случае, параметр попросту не нужен, поэтому способ с file.inc будет правильнее...
Reply
#13

Короче промблема такова я написал системку на file
сделал команду добавления домов из игры
ну вот они не покупаются пишет "вы не возле дома"
а самый первый который я добавлял в ручную покупается но сервано пишет "вы не возле дома"
Сохранение домов:
http://pastebin.com/szDnx84Y
Загрузка:
http://pastebin.com/3T74ucvt
Команды добавления
http://pastebin.com/qRjrwAbf
Команда покупки
http://pastebin.com/gT7vtv3R
Reply
#14

Quote:
Originally Posted by sk47
View Post
Команда покупки
http://pastebin.com/gT7vtv3R
http://pastebin.com/zhy913fC
Другие команды не смотрел. Посмотри свой код и посмотри на мой и если в другом коде есть ошибки, то исправь их сам.
Reply
#15

окей спс работает=)
Reply
#16

Quote:
Originally Posted by sk47
View Post
окей спс работает=)
А ты проанализировал свои ошибки?
Reply
#17

ZiGGi да
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)